编程库是指什么程序的语言
-
编程库是指一系列预先编写好的程序代码集合,用于提供特定功能的程序开发工具。它们包含了各种函数、类、方法等代码片段,可以被其他程序调用和重复使用,从而提高开发效率和代码的可维护性。
编程库可以分为两大类:系统库和第三方库。系统库是指由编程语言的开发者提供的标准库,它们通常包含了常用的基础功能和数据结构,如文件操作、字符串处理、数学计算等。常见的系统库有C语言的标准库(如stdio.h、stdlib.h)和Python的标准库(如os模块、re模块)等。
第三方库是由独立的开发者或组织开发并提供的,用于扩展编程语言功能的库。它们可以用来解决特定的问题或提供特定的功能,如网络请求、图形处理、数据分析等。第三方库通常需要通过包管理器进行安装和管理,如Python的pip、JavaScript的npm等。常见的第三方库有Python的numpy、pandas、matplotlib等,JavaScript的jQuery、React、Vue.js等。
使用编程库可以帮助开发者快速实现复杂的功能,避免重复编写相同的代码,提高代码的复用性和可维护性。同时,编程库也可以提供高效的算法和数据结构,帮助开发者提升程序的性能和效率。因此,掌握和使用编程库是编程语言的重要一环。
1年前 -
编程库是指一组已经写好的代码和函数的集合,用于简化程序开发过程。编程库可以提供各种不同的功能和特性,例如图形界面、网络通信、数据库操作等。通过使用编程库,开发人员可以避免重复编写相同的代码,提高开发效率。
编程库通常由编程语言提供,每种编程语言都有自己的编程库。以下是一些常见的编程语言及其对应的编程库:
-
Python:Python是一种广泛使用的高级编程语言,具有丰富的编程库。其中一些常用的编程库包括NumPy(用于科学计算)、Pandas(用于数据处理和分析)、Django(用于Web开发)等。
-
Java:Java是一种面向对象的编程语言,也有许多编程库可供使用。一些常见的Java编程库包括Spring(用于企业级应用开发)、Apache HttpClient(用于网络通信)、JUnit(用于单元测试)等。
-
JavaScript:JavaScript是一种广泛应用于Web开发的脚本语言,也有许多编程库可供选择。一些常见的JavaScript编程库包括jQuery(用于DOM操作和事件处理)、React(用于构建用户界面)、Express.js(用于构建Web应用程序)等。
-
C++:C++是一种通用的编程语言,广泛应用于系统开发和游戏开发等领域。一些常见的C++编程库包括STL(标准模板库,提供了许多常用的数据结构和算法)、OpenGL(用于图形渲染)、Boost(提供了许多扩展功能)等。
-
Ruby:Ruby是一种简单而强大的脚本语言,也有许多编程库可供选择。一些常见的Ruby编程库包括Ruby on Rails(用于Web开发)、RSpec(用于测试)、Nokogiri(用于解析HTML和XML)等。
总之,编程库是编程语言提供的一种工具,用于简化程序开发过程。不同的编程语言提供了不同的编程库,开发人员可以根据自己的需求选择合适的编程库来提高开发效率。
1年前 -
-
编程库是一组预先编写好的程序代码的集合,用于在特定编程语言中开发应用程序。它们提供了一系列函数、类和方法,以帮助开发人员快速、高效地实现特定的功能。编程库通常由其他开发人员编写,并共享给其他开发人员使用。
编程库可以包含各种不同的功能和特性,如图形用户界面(GUI)控件、网络通信、数据库连接、数学计算、文件处理等。通过使用编程库,开发人员可以避免重复编写大量的代码,并可以利用已经经过测试和优化的代码来实现特定的功能。这样可以大大提高开发效率,减少错误,并使应用程序更加稳定和可靠。
编程库通常以库文件的形式提供,这些库文件包含已编译的二进制代码。在编程语言中,可以使用特定的语法和关键字来引用和调用库中的函数和方法。开发人员可以通过导入库文件,将其包含到自己的代码中,从而可以使用库中提供的功能。
使用编程库的一般步骤如下:
-
寻找合适的编程库:根据需要的功能,从互联网上搜索并选择合适的编程库。可以参考其他开发人员的推荐或评价来选择可靠的库。
-
下载和安装:下载编程库的库文件,并按照库的安装说明进行安装。安装过程可能会涉及将库文件放置在特定的文件夹中,并配置开发环境以识别库文件。
-
导入库:在自己的代码中引入库文件,以便可以使用库中提供的功能。这通常通过使用特定的语法和关键字来实现,具体语法和关键字取决于所使用的编程语言。
-
调用库中的函数或方法:使用库中提供的函数或方法来实现特定的功能。可以通过传递参数来调用函数或方法,并接收返回值。
-
测试和调试:在使用编程库的功能之前,进行测试和调试以确保代码的正确性和稳定性。可以使用库中提供的示例代码作为参考,并根据自己的需求进行适当的修改。
需要注意的是,不同的编程语言有不同的编程库,并且不同的编程库可能适用于不同的应用场景。因此,在选择和使用编程库时,需要考虑到所使用的编程语言和具体的需求。
1年前 -